Scholarships, Grants, and Awards at the American University of Barbados, School of Medicine

Scholarships, grants, and awards are offered by the American University of Barbados (School of Medicine) to selected students. Those who are eligible could get merit-based academic scholarships, awards, or grants for community service and extracurricular activities. All students/candidates seeking admission are eligible to apply for any of the grants, scholarships, and awards available at AUB. It is time to study medicine at the American University of Barbados.

Scholarships (From $4,000 to $20,000) 

Of the American University of Barbados Scholarships, Grants and Awards, scholarships ranging from $4,000 to $20,000 appear to be good options. The scholarships will be conferred to chosen applicants who have shown high academic achievements and have met the eligibility criteria set by the Scholarship Committee. On the part of the recipients of scholarships, they need to maintain the specified GPA for all scholarships and need to complete the program successfully.

Faculty’s Scholarship ($8,000)

This opportunity will be offered to applicants who have an undergraduate degree GPA of 3.25 or higher.

Foundation Scholarship ($4,000)

This scholarship will be provided to those applicants having an undergraduate degree GPA of 3.0 or higher.

President’s Scholarship (Worth $16,000)

President’s Scholarship with a worth of $16,000 will be offered to applicants with an undergraduate degree GPA of 3.75 or higher.

Dean’s Scholarship ($12,000)

This will be offered to applicants with an undergraduate GPA of 3.50 or higher.

Chairman’s Scholarship (Worth $20,000)

Applicants who have an undergraduate GPA of 3.80 or higher will be offered this scholarship.

Grants at The American University of Barbados

Following are the details regarding the grants available for interested students. Let’s find them out.

Community Service Grant (Up to $2,000)

This grant may be awarded to qualified applicants if they have shown leadership in community service nationally or internationally.

Extracurricular and Sports Grant (Up to $2,000) 

Those applicants who demonstrate exceptional performance in sports or other extracurricular activities may be offered this grant.

Caricom Student Grant (Worth $7,000)

To be eligible for this grant, the applicants need to have citizenship of the Caricom nations. There is a grant worth $7,000 that will be conferred to students who have citizenship proof of a Caricom nation.

Barbadian Grant (Worth $10,000)

Eligible Barbadian students with proof of citizenship will be awarded this grant worth $10,000. Therefore, students who receive this grant will not be eligible for the Caricom student grant.

Awards Available at The American University of Barbados

Below are the awards available and offered at the American University of Barbados. Let’s now check out the details.

Award for Research (Up to $1,000)

Those students who have published review articles, research articles, case reports, etc. in journals that are indexed in Scopus, PubMed, Index Copernicus, Web of Science, Index Medicus, or other famous and recognized indexing bodies will be offered this award.

Excellence in Academics (Up to $2,000)

This is an award worth up to $2,000 will be given to the any American University of Barbados who scores 230 or above in the USMLE Step 1 examination on the first attempt and this will also be offered to those who score 240 or above in USMLE Step 2 (CK/CS) examination in the first attempt.

Policies for General Scholarships, Grants, and Awards

  • All grants, scholarships, and awards will be at the discretion of the committee and could be withdrawn or amended without any prior notice.
  • In any given intake, each grant and scholarship could be offered to a limited number of qualifying students.
  • All awards and scholarships will be applicable based on pro rata.
  • It is to be noted that scores gained (obtained) in national pre-medical examinations like NEET, MCAT, etc. might be considered for awarding scholarships as well.
  • If a scholarship or grant awardee leaves the institution prior to the completion of the MD program, his or her eligibility for the scholarship will no longer be active (he or she becomes ineligible for the scholarship) and then will have to deposit full fees for the duration of his/her study at the American University of Barbados.
  • Remember, all grants, scholarships, and awards are subject to verification of the documents submitted and could be revoked if supporting credentials/documents are found to be fake or forged.
  • Students who are scholarship or grant awardees are expected to maintain consistent academic performance and passing grades in all of their subjects throughout the duration of their studies till the completion of their MD program to retain the grants or scholarships.
  • The committee will calculate the eligibility on an undergraduate GPA on a 4-point scale.
  • All figures are represented in United States Dollars.
